Bulk insert table lock
WebOct 30, 2024 · A bulk insert might lock a table for hours, preventing other inserts from happening (as well as select, updates, or deletes). Or, from a security perspective, it can … WebApr 3, 2024 · To perform a bulk load, you can use bcp Utility, Integration Services, or select rows from a staging table. As the diagram suggests, a bulk load: Does not pre-sort the data. Data is inserted into rowgroups in the order it is received. If the batch size is >= 102400, the rows are directly into the compressed rowgroups.
Bulk insert table lock
Did you know?
WebJan 10, 2024 · 3) Table locking is affected by the number of rows inserted in the table. Initially, row locking is used, but then the server escalates it to page locks and then table locks as needed for efficiency. This happens regardless of whether you are using bulk insert or individual insert statements. WebNov 21, 2014 · ALTER TABLE [dbo]. [RAWfctDailyHoldings] SET (LOCK_ESCALATION = AUTO) GO the block dbcc inputbuffer return BULK INSERT [dbo]. [myrawtable] FROM '\\fileserver\file.bcp' WITH (CODEPAGE='RAW',DATAFILETYPE='char',FIELDTERMINATOR=' ',ROWTERMINATOR='\n',TABLOCK,ORDER …
WebFeb 21, 2024 · This lock type allows to process multiple bulk insert operations against the same table simultaneously and this option also decreases the total time of the bulk … WebDec 30, 2015 · CREATE DATABASE LocksDB; GO -- Create partition functions ALTER DATABASE [LocksDB] ADD FILEGROUP FG10000; ALTER DATABASE [LocksDB] ADD FILE (NAME = LocksDB_Data_10000, FILENAME = 'C:\DATA\LocksDB_Data_10000.NDF', SIZE = 100MB, FILEGROWTH = 150MB) TO FILEGROUP FG10000; ALTER …
WebJun 16, 2024 · Bulk Update locks (BU) – this lock is designed to be used by bulk import operations when issued with a TABLOCK argument/hint. When a bulk update lock is acquired, other processes will not be able to … WebMar 2, 2024 · The first argument for BULK INSERT should be a table name or a view name. By default, it expects that the schema of the file would be identical to the schema of the target where the data is being imported. …
WebDec 11, 2024 · Unfortunately, we encounter a deadlock situation when using the SqlBulkCopy class to insert rows into a single table using multiple machines / processes concurrently. In order to achieve best database write-out performance we use the SqlBulkCopy class with SqlBulkCopyOptions.TableLock. According to the msdn …
WebSep 27, 2024 · In this step, you create a linked service to link your database in Azure SQL Database to the data factory. Open Manage tab from the left pane. On the Linked … fromagerie victoria st-georges de beauceWebSep 11, 2024 · For bulk inserts, there are Session.bulk_save_objects() and Session.bulk_insert_mappings(). Session.bulk_save_objects() takes a list of ORM instances as the parameter, similar to Session.add_all(), while Session.bulk_insert_mappings() takes a list of mappings/dictionaries as the parameter. … fromagerie victoria saint georgesWebIn this mode, “bulk inserts” use the special AUTO-INC table-level lock and hold it until the end of the statement. This applies to all INSERT ... SELECT , REPLACE ... SELECT, and LOAD DATA statements. Only one statement holding … fromagerie vesin thollon les memisesWebFeb 28, 2024 · This SQL Server connector is supported for the following capabilities: ① Azure integration runtime ② Self-hosted integration runtime For a list of data stores that are supported as sources or sinks by the copy activity, see the Supported data stores table. Specifically, this SQL Server connector supports: SQL Server version 2005 and above. fromagerie victoria poutineWebUsing TABLOCK will reduce concurrency but will immediately take a table lock on the target table. As long as you can guarantee that just one session will insert into the table this will avoid unnecessary row or page locks and will prevent lock escalation. from ages 3 to 6 the brain\\u0027s neural networkWebTable locking. During the bulk insert we can put an exclusive lock on the table, this speeds up the insert operation, the goal is to measure it in various scenarios. BatchSize: this parameter defines the size of each single batch that is sent to the server. There is no clear documentation about the effect of this parameter on performances. fromagerie victoria st jeromeWebIn this mode, “bulk inserts” use the special AUTO-INC table-level lock and hold it until the end of the statement. This applies to all INSERT ... SELECT , REPLACE ... SELECT, and LOAD DATA statements. Only one statement holding … fromage selection super c